Ankle surgery

I have had ankle surgery, but was from a fall and a bad break. For mine they implanted a plate and screws to hold in place. Now I am speculating but is it a ligament repair they are doing? I know he has done well with his back surgery, so the challenging part would be what type of weight bearing he will be doing or if he will need crutches or a walker while it heals. Because of my arm and neck issues, I couldn't use crutches so they packed it well enough so I could weight bear inside the walking boot, and the boot was one with more straps to support more pressure. All of that was decided before the surgery. Now as far as those first few days, getting up was a nightmare with pain, when I would step on it. Like everything the more I did it the better it got. They will block it out so for the first day it will be completely numb, and sometimes you can get almost two days out of those blocks, if enough are given. I have had other foot surgeries and always elect the blocks over generals. The blocks are localized at the foot level, although sometimes they will do a block at the lumbar and just hit the one leg completely. Good luck and hope it all works out.
